Code Ann. § 12-39-120","heading":"Auditor may enter and examine buildings (except dwellings) to ascertain value.","body":"For the purpose of enabling the auditor to determine the value of any taxable personal property and other improvements, he may enter and fully examine all buildings and structures (except dwellings), of whatever kind, which are not by law expressly exempt from taxation.","path":["Title 12 - TAXATION","CHAPTER 39 County Auditors"],"source_url":"https://www.scstatehouse.gov/code/t12c039.php","current_through":"2025 Session of the General Assembly","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-02T06:36:24Z","sha256":"ca320eae0b8ee5ab7abf00567abb9789b76570a4cd0eecf6d53cf25e7fbb90cf","source_id":"us-sc","stale":false,"prev":"us-sc/s.c.-code-ann.-12-39-70","next":"us-sc/s.c.-code-ann.-12-39-140"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
